Summary

CVE-2024-10044 is a critical-severity SSRF (CWE-918) vulnerability in Lm-Sys Fastchat. Its CVSS base score is 9.3 (Critical).

Operationally, exploitation aligns with the MITRE ATT&CK technique Exploit Public-Facing Application (T1190); ranked at the 44.8th percentile by exploit likelihood (below the median); it is not currently listed in the CISA KEV catalog; a public proof-of-concept is referenced.

Vulnerability details

A Server-Side Request Forgery (SSRF) vulnerability exists in the POST /worker_generate_stream API endpoint of the Controller API Server in lm-sys/fastchat, as of commit e208d5677c6837d590b81cb03847c0b9de100765. This vulnerability allows attackers to exploit the victim controller API server's credentials to perform unauthorized web…

more

actions or access unauthorized web resources by combining it with the POST /register_worker endpoint.

Why these techniques?

The SSRF vulnerability in the public-facing Controller API Server enables exploitation of a public-facing application (T1190) and allows attackers to use server credentials for unauthorized access to internal web resources, facilitating network service discovery (T1046).
